Partnership Development Manager Jobs in Nevada: Frequently Asked Questions

Which companies in Nevada sponsor visas for partnership development managers?

Las Vegas-based employers with documented H-1B visa sponsorship histories in business development roles include MGM Resorts International, Caesars Entertainment, and Switch, a data center company headquartered in Nevada. Gaming technology firms like Scientific Games and Everi Holdings also hire partnership professionals. Reno attracts sponsorship activity from logistics and e-commerce companies operating regional hubs there.

Which visa types are most common for partnership development manager roles in Nevada?

The H-1B is the most common visa for partnership development managers, provided the role qualifies as a specialty occupation requiring a bachelor's degree in a specific field such as business, marketing, or communications. Candidates with extraordinary achievements may pursue the O-1A. Canadians and Mexicans may be eligible for TN visas under the NAFTA/USMCA professional category for management consultants.

Which cities in Nevada have the most partnership development manager sponsorship jobs?

Las Vegas accounts for the overwhelming majority of partnership development manager sponsorship activity in Nevada, driven by its concentration of gaming, hospitality, entertainment technology, and convention industry employers. Reno is a secondary market with growing demand, particularly from logistics firms and technology companies. Henderson, as a Las Vegas suburb with expanding corporate headquarters, occasionally surfaces relevant opportunities as well.

Are there any Nevada-specific considerations for partnership development managers pursuing visa sponsorship?

Nevada's partnership development market is heavily shaped by the gaming and hospitality industry, which means many roles involve regulated environments requiring background clearance alongside standard visa requirements. The Nevada Gaming Control Board licensing process is separate from immigration but may extend hiring timelines. Employers in this sector tend to be large, established organizations with dedicated HR teams experienced in sponsoring international candidates.

What is the prevailing wage for sponsored partnership development manager jobs in Nevada?

U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
